About Me
Back in 1982, a dear friend started me in leather work by teaching me to carve a wallet back and assemble it. Never did the two of us realize that I would be making a living from a much-enjoyed hobby. Since that first project, I have gradually learned more and more and grown more and more into what is now a full-time business. Those days I spent in front of K-Marts in the freezing cold or blistering heat taught me what people wanted. While I was a part-time vendor in a mall in Greenville, Mississippi, I learned how to sell and stock the right amount of items. As my business grew, I longed to do leather wholesale as my one and only job. On June 30, 2003, I left the barber shop and my full-part-time job and become a full-time leather producer! A dream come true.

It is a great joy to me today to encounter people who are still wearing the belt I made for them five, ten, fifteen years ago. It's great knowing that my belts reach from California to New York to Germany. I truly appreciate those people who recognize me and yell, "Hello, Mr. Belt Man!" I have made many friends through those years of making and selling leather part time. Now my business has grown to be full-time.

I continue the same process that has been successful for me. I have always used highest grade American tanned leather whenever it was available. My belts are stripped from 9 to 10 double shoulders to assure that they will stand up under tough wearing conditions. I make sizes 20 through 58 in two widths, 1 l/4 inches or l l/2 inch minus l/16th of an inch to allow the belts to slip through belt loops easily. All my belts are made with two snaps (gold or silver) to allow for the changing of buckles with a plain buckle to match. The belt keeper is also included.

I also handcraft key rings and wrist bands of the same grade leather. Along with the belts, these items can be dyed in light brown, dark brown, black, red, green, blue, purple, pink, mahogany, and white. I specialize in Greek letter designs and Masonic and Eastern Star bodies.

As a sideline, I supply wholesale money clips in gold or silver and tie bars and pendants in gold. Many different inserts are available in the same Greek and Masonic designs as used in the belts.
